Output 3f308982cb8411e6ab4157d0815b57ea4007ecdbdf4e4c2a6995093435fef173:0

value
18128540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ce90ce2f8185b47b744d85371419176f3fdde06 OP_EQUALVERIFY OP_CHECKSIG
address
181fYCdTBLQnB4RavFnmaWJVF5hfoFfyLq
transaction
3f308982cb8411e6ab4157d0815b57ea4007ecdbdf4e4c2a6995093435fef173
confirmations
170420
spent
true